
Applications
Assembly
The process of combining multiple parts to make components or products, assembly is performed in various manufacturing sectors, including machinery, electronics, and electrical sectors.
Assembly covers various tasks, including assembly of small precision parts and large and heavy workpieces.
Material Handling
The process of moving materials, parts, and products from one place to another, material handling is performed in almost all industries, not just in the manufacturing industry.
For material handling, industrial robots are most commonly used for various purposes, including high-speed transport of small parts and handling of heavy objects that humans cannot carry.
Machine Tending
A critical process in the machinery industry, machine tending involves loading parts into NC machine tools and unloading them after their machining is complete. Loading and unloading processing materials into and out of forging and press machines are also classified as machine tending.
Pick & Place
Picking, also known as “pick and place,” is the process of grabbing workpieces from a conveyor belt and sorting them at high speed.
For this purpose, uniquely shaped robots called the parallel link type (or delta type) are used.
Painting
Painting is the process of applying paint on product surfaces, forming a coating film or finish.
Because most paint materials are highly volatile, explosion-proof robots and painting equipment are used for this process.
Sealing / Dispensing
Sealing is the process of applying sealant or adhesive to enhance airtightness and fill the space between materials.
Sealing is performed for many products, such as passenger vehicles and home appliances.
Silicon Wafer Handling
Wafer transfer is the handling of wafers in the front-end process of semiconductor manufacturing equipment.
This process uses clean robots and requires high-precision, high-speed and smooth movement.
